The Assignment
Riverview Homestead, a Bed and Breakfast, is a small 2 room B&B located adjacent to the Murrumbidgee River near the ACT in Australia. It is owned and managed by Les and Robyn Beresford.
For some time, Riverview Homestead have offered a country experience within a 1/2 hour drive from the nation’s capital. Besides the wonderful river views, the small farm offers the opportunity to pick hazelnuts in season and spend time relaxing in an idyllic environment.
